@mathualfred: Why do so many people earn good salaries but still struggle financially? The problem isn’t always income. The real difference between financial stress and financial freedom is having a plan for your money. In this conversation, I explain why financial planning is the foundation of wealth creation and why every shilling should have a purpose before it’s spent. The people who build lasting wealth don’t simply earn more—they manage money differently. If your salary disappears before the month ends, if saving feels impossible, or if investing always gets postponed, this conversation could completely change the way you think about money. In this episode, we discuss: • Why financial crises happen—even to high-income earners • The 25/50/25 budgeting formula for building wealth • How to create an emergency fund that protects your future • The habits that lead to financial independence • Why passive income matters more than a bigger salary • Smart debt management and avoiding lifestyle inflation • Retirement planning and preparing for life beyond employment • Diversification, wealth protection, and succession planning • The financial systems that help you build generational wealth One lesson I hope stays with you: Money is a tool. Purpose is the master. The way you manage your income today determines the options you’ll have tomorrow. Every budget gives your money direction. Every investment moves you closer to financial freedom. Every intentional financial decision strengthens your future. Building wealth isn’t about luck. It’s about consistency, discipline, and giving your money a clear assignment every time you earn it.
